Construction method for cutter suction type corner amplitude underground diaphragm wall pipeline crossing
The invention discloses a construction method for cutter suction type corner amplitude underground diaphragm wall pipeline crossing. The construction method comprises the following steps of: carrying out amplitude division on a reinforcement cage to obtain a special-shaped amplitude reinforcement cage containing a pipeline area, and a corner amplitude reinforcement cage, and cutting off the longitudinal bars and the horizontally distributed bars of the special-shaped amplitude reinforcement cage at a pipeline interference part to form grooves; carrying out guide groove construction on two sides of a pipeline through a grooving machine, and then, carrying out grooving and hole cleaning on a soil body on the lower part of the pipeline through a gas lift reverse circulation drilling machine; lowering the reinforcement cage; pouring concrete; and after initial setting of the concrete, conducting soil body excavation, chiseling the concrete at the groove position of the special-shaped reinforcement cage, splicing the vertical steel bars at the top and the bottom of the pipeline, additionally arranging stirrups along the circumferential direction of the pipeline, welding the stirrups and the vertical steel bars, additionally arranging the horizontal distribution steel bars at the top of the pipeline, and welding the horizontal distribution steel bars and the vertical steel bars. The pipeline penetrating through the diaphragm wall does not need to be changed and moved, and the construction method has the advantages of being safe, reliable and convenient in construction, the construction cost is saved, and the construction period is shortened.
